China launches reconnaissance satellite
Posted: Sat, Apr 27, 2024, 10:09 AM ET (1409 GMT)
China launched its second Yaogan-42 reconnaissance satellite April 20. A Long March 2D rocket lifted off from the Xichang Satellite Launch Center at 7:45 pm EDT (2345 GMT) and placed the Yaogan-42 (02) into a mid-inclination orbit. The first Yaogan-42 satellite launched early this month into a similar orbit. The Yaogan series of satellites are used for reconnaissance, although the payloads on the Yaogan-42 series have not been publicly disclosed.
